I have a plain Arch laptop with i3 which I really like. I also want to install openbox but I was wondering if there was a way to use the setup of OB that ArchLabs uses. It would be nice if that could be done. It saves a lot of setup work.
Pretty sure the openbox configs are on the ArchLabs git page. Check Dobbie’s signature for a link.
You could copy over openbox configs from here https://bitbucket.org/archlabslinux/skel/src/master/openbox-home/.config/
and apply themes from here https://bitbucket.org/archlabslinux/themes/src/master/Themes/

Probably want to look at the .xprofile file as well. A lot of the openbox autostart commands were moved to there so they would start with any window manager.
